Doyle the hero as Pat’s advance in Europe

St. Patrick's Athletic 2 Shakhter Karagandy 0 (St. Pat's won 3-2 on aggregate)

Having scored the winner against IBV of Iceland in the previous round, Derek Doyle worked the oracle again for St Patrick's Athletic tonight.

Doyle scored the clinching second goal to seal St. Pat’s passage through to the third round of the Europa League following this stirring win over Kazakhstan side Shakter Karagandy at Richmond Park.

Trailing 2-1 from the first leg, St. Pat’s - roared on by a big home crowd - started superbly with central defender Evan McMillan’s header from a corner squirming to the net to give the home side a 14th minute lead.

Winger Doyle then added the second on 69 minutes when he slid in to shoot home from Derek Pender’s cross.

The win maintains the Irish side’s European adventure as they now travel to Ukraine next week to play Karpaty Lviv in the next round.
